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Blue-spotted Comet Darner | Pixie Foam |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(hayvan) | Fungi (mantar)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Eklem bacaklılar) | Ascomycota (Asklı mantarlar) |
| Class | Insecta (böcek) | Lecanoromycetes (Lecanoromycetes) |
| Order | Odonata (Kızböcekleri) | Lecanorales (Lecanorales) |
| Family | Aeshnidae | Stereocaulaceae |
| Genus | Anax | Stereocaulon |
| Species | Anax concolor | Stereocaulon pileatum |
